England will be looking to make full use of a life line thrown to them by Israel with a victory over Croatia when the two teams play in their next Euro 2008 qualifier on Wednesday.

Israel's victory over Russia has opened a back door for England to grab qualification to the tournament if they manage to beat Croatia in the midweek. With the coach and the players receiving a lot of flak from the media for their poor performance in the campaign so far, the team will be keen to end the campaign with a convincing victory against a team that will end the campaign top of the group table.

Steve McClaren has recalled David Beckham back into the squad after the winger missed last month's clash against Russia and Israel due to injury.  However England will be without the defensive duo of John Terry and Rio Ferdinand along with Michael Owen and Wayne Rooney with four players out injured. Owen Hargreaves missed the Austria clash and it is unclear if he is fit for the crucial Croatia game. England will be coming into the game with a hard fought 1-0 victory over Austria in the friendly on Friday and will be looking to take full advantage of Croatia's shock 2-0 defeat to Macedonia in the qualifier match on Saturday.

Goran Maznov and Ilco Naumoski scored late in the game to earn a well deserved victory against Croatia who have already qualified for the Euro 2008 finals. Croatia coach Slaven Bilic though will be hoping his players can end on a high at Wembley. With vociferous fans backing them, England will expect to do well against their opponents.
